A 24 volt solar system uses multiple solar panels wired in series to produce a higher DC voltage output around 24V. This 24V DC electricity is stored in batteries and converted by inverters to power 24V appliances and equipment. Understanding the Basics of. . For most homes, the residential solar panel size is the 60-cell module, measuring about 65″ × 39″ and producing roughly 300–400 watts per panel. They're compact, versatile, and easier to install on smaller or more complex rooftops. 5″) aren't arbitrary – they represent the optimal balance between power output, installation ease, and roof space utilization.
